Continental AllSeasonContact 2 is a allround tyre made in total of 247 sizes, ranging from R15 to R15 - this particular dimension is R19, which means it fits to a 19 inch/482.6mm diameter wheel. 255/50 R19 is 90mm wider than the narrowest dimension (165) and 30mm narrower than the widest one (285). This tyre profile of 50 means the sidewall height of the tyre is 50% of the tyre width (255mm), which results in 127.5mm sidewall height. In 255/50 R19, there are 2 possible speed indexes for Continental AllSeasonContact 2 - "T","W", which are good for speeds up to 190, 270 km/h.
